Cells require energy to perform various vital functions. The energy they require is obtained from the foods they consume. The food molecules contain energy in the form of chemical bonds. However, cells cannot directly use the energy these molecules possess. Through a series of enzyme catalyzed reactions, the energy is harvested and is used to synthesize ATP (adenosine triphosphate), the energy currency of cells.
